A new furanocoumarin, clauhainanin A (1), together with seven known furanocoumarins (2-8), were isolated from the stems and leaves of Clausena hainanensis. The structure of 1 was elucidated by extensive spectroscopic methods and the known compounds were identified by comparisons with data reported in the literature. All known compounds (2-8) were isolated from C. hainanensis for the first time. All isolated compounds were evaluated for their cytotoxicities against five human cancer cell lines: HL-60, SMMC-7721, A-549, MCF-7 and SW480 in vitro. Compounds 1-8 exhibited significant inhibitory effects with IC values ranging from 1.36 to 18.96 μM.
